Pre-Operation Checks
It is the owner’s responsibility to check all of the items listed below
to be certain all preparation steps are completed before you use
your boat. Checking these items periodically will soon become a
habit. If leaks or other abnormal conditions are found, stop using
the boat and contact your Nautique dealer to have the problem
corrected.
Get into the habit of performing these checks in the same order
each time so that it becomes routine.
• Make sure to check all safety items.
• Check that drain plug is properly installed.
• Check condition of propeller.
• Check that all batteries are fully charged and at the proper
level.
• Verify the amount of fuel in the fuel tanks.
• Be sure the lights, horn, bilge pumps and other electrical
equipment are in operating condition.
• Check that steering system operates properly.
• Make sure your float plan is submitted to a responsible
person.
• Refer to your engine operation and maintenance manual for
additional pre-operation checks.
